A_Fann 2021-07-29 12:01 采纳率: 90.9%
浏览 91
已结题

mysql怎么实现删除表的一行数据后将该行数据备份至另外一个表

有a,b两个表,字段都是相同的,将a表的一行数据删除时,将该行数据插入b表

  • 写回答

1条回答 默认 最新

  • 404警告 2021-07-29 12:08
    关注

    使用触发器

    CREATE TRIGGER '触发器名称' BEFORE DELETE ON '删除的主表名称' FOR EACH ROW BEGIN INSERT INTO '备份表名称' SELECT * FROM '主表名称' where id=old.id; END
    
    
    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论

报告相同问题?

问题事件

  • 系统已结题 8月7日
  • 已采纳回答 7月30日
  • 创建了问题 7月29日